Technical Specifications

  • Core Count: 12-core
  • Base Clock Speed: 3.00GHz
  • Max Turbo Frequency: 3.70GHz
  • Ultrapath Interconnect (UPI) Speed: 10.4GT/s
  • UPI Links: 3
  • Instruction Set: 64-bit with Intel® SSE4.2, Intel® AVX, Intel® AVX2, and Intel® AVX-512 extensions

Memory Specifications

  • Maximum Memory: 768GB (dependent on memory type)
  • Memory Type: DDR4-2666
  • Maximum Memory Speed: 2.67GHz
  • Memory Channels: 6 channels
  • ECC Memory Support: Yes

Cache and Lithography

  • L3 Cache: 24.75MB
  • Lithography: 14nm
  • Thermal Design Power (TDP): 150W
  • Socket Compatibility: FCLGA3647

UPI Speed

The UPI (Ultra Path Interconnect) Speed is an essential feature of the Dell Intel Xeon Gold 6136 Processor, offering a blazing fast UPI speed of 10.4GT/s. UPI is an interconnect technology that facilitates communication between processors within a system, enabling efficient data transfer and synchronization.

Enhanced System Scalability

A higher UPI speed allows for faster communication between multiple processors, enhancing system scalability. With a UPI speed of 10.4GT/s, the Dell Intel Xeon Gold 6136 Processor enables efficient communication and coordination between multiple processors in a multi-socket configuration, ensuring that your system can handle demanding workloads with ease.
